From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 1AC23A00C2; Thu, 24 Nov 2022 16:08:26 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 02BDF42DC4; Thu, 24 Nov 2022 16:08:26 +0100 (CET) Received: from mga11.intel.com (mga11.intel.com [192.55.52.93]) by mails.dpdk.org (Postfix) with ESMTP id 337CD42DBF for ; Thu, 24 Nov 2022 16:08:24 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1669302504; x=1700838504; h=date:from:to:cc:subject:message-id:references: in-reply-to:mime-version; bh=zUml1HK5sdp7B5Rp0CKuDOTFxWh9a2UP2VwdDnJdR34=; b=YvbHBV1E29YadvwyNoEKE6/zJ0G1bEOoEGwgC/LYGP2J0zkmC3BDMVbJ UzaKNRT6Q1YlsMt46wViezzuam0/gj9Ui8U3ZNN32qas4UKmw7IEx4uQP 6uwnhOYR7jL12jzR5ejgcBYknQaVNg+w8uLHcBeemIbb51SBUjoqifMID I4iIY0PbHV0Rm8ZQocvqyfY9K9UejfwqZ1WGzXGg+x8yBaz/CZfrb/m/C tUuir13tSNWEwpbheDk/C4M+roVa1aHbUoZHppiiWNSfSOvF1/Y54T4Ew ffWMRhrkyPXTiZI4kcLpEhytVLPVOxVQQ+aVUNTUEPLTw6zaQZfnqWYcn Q==; X-IronPort-AV: E=McAfee;i="6500,9779,10541"; a="311955575" X-IronPort-AV: E=Sophos;i="5.96,190,1665471600"; d="scan'208";a="311955575" Received: from fmsmga008.fm.intel.com ([10.253.24.58]) by fmsmga102.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 24 Nov 2022 07:08:23 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10541"; a="705788836" X-IronPort-AV: E=Sophos;i="5.96,190,1665471600"; d="scan'208";a="705788836" Received: from fmsmsx602.amr.corp.intel.com ([10.18.126.82]) by fmsmga008.fm.intel.com with ESMTP; 24 Nov 2022 07:08:16 -0800 Received: from fmsmsx610.amr.corp.intel.com (10.18.126.90) by fmsmsx602.amr.corp.intel.com (10.18.126.82)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2375.31; Thu, 24 Nov 2022 07:08:12 -0800 Received: from fmsmsx601.amr.corp.intel.com (10.18.126.81) by fmsmsx610.amr.corp.intel.com (10.18.126.90)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2375.31; Thu, 24 Nov 2022 07:08:11 -0800 Received: from fmsedg601.ED.cps.intel.com (10.1.192.135) by fmsmsx601.amr.corp.intel.com (10.18.126.81)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.16 via Frontend Transport; Thu, 24 Nov 2022 07:08:11 -0800 Received: from NAM12-BN8-obe.outbound.protection.outlook.com (104.47.55.174) by edgegateway.intel.com (192.55.55.70)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2375.31; Thu, 24 Nov 2022 07:08:11 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=Hc0IBLW1zsMzbpX24AW1B+DL8O6uo6Ciy1yzq/5Z+h911QNRU7CuMRSuYoyqPoqyAnj5XYpIzO3HbfGGYqRd+9MwMcTLL8cIYLhZ1F7mJe78r+3sOHbKbyGEfrxx+sye3snoR2r80T3rlBAFdITMZ3/EJtw2Y8xVMJrOW5OVLMMn3aE7u3lBV+HoUIGC0NFd+/L+T9T6MCysi6RdroU0Oxh7HipxqRRQ4pUnlc6IFa1vn10Xu9Sbi6ewUKqXSWnhQKD2Z3B5fonJT3NpKV1FkapAbKxAkge4uSExWwZhqusSHdFJKDHZdNOsZRvew1S8OzW78agVXOYcQWeWPvke2g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=Rzf/5g6l3J0WHLK3YWWWosNMBl/Va1iLPAEd5x7jRII=; b=frznDS9XCz3c/neNFSu8aXoXlARGdhh1kZ3+wr+xHFwidosLzFOPbS9uVJ5yexRjlgZj1Yo8EdXOSey9yHK8sxsF2Q4933LaKcqvnkRrxpeo5u1cEN7rNCPzGuS3H9xjxSb6iOE2bQ1aFnTi1SHSAFtaFA50otadiOv+2/D8yU5L046Pf6l4jDJi+tF/7SuymFAs2RGxu7tyAZ7fo3KtXXaNDkhyA5a4TsOyyjM35hi4qUzyknoQ5ziPJNp6xxCG1nnD0cU1x4LofWE2hQ2iv9QabJ5jBilo+KMj1Wdn7kCK+PB5cs77NNT2Cjoh1HUMssFXgcHLuhr38JLtaIvzfw==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; Received: from MWHPR11MB1629.namprd11.prod.outlook.com (2603:10b6:301:d::21) by CY5PR11MB6283.namprd11.prod.outlook.com (2603:10b6:930:21::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.5834.9; Thu, 24 Nov 2022 15:08:09 +0000 Received: from MWHPR11MB1629.namprd11.prod.outlook.com ([fe80::18bd:edae:ad31:a228]) by MWHPR11MB1629.namprd11.prod.outlook.com ([fe80::18bd:edae:ad31:a228%3]) with mapi id 15.20.5857.018; Thu, 24 Nov 2022 15:08:09 +0000 Date: Thu, 24 Nov 2022 15:08:03 +0000 From: Bruce Richardson To: Thomas Monjalon CC: David Marchand , Subject: Re: [PATCH v4] mailmap: add file to DPDK Message-ID: References: <20201020130722.304989-1-bruce.richardson@intel.com> <2157985.1BCLMh4Saa@thomas> Content-Type: text/plain; charset="us-ascii" Content-Disposition: inline In-Reply-To: <2157985.1BCLMh4Saa@thomas> X-ClientProxiedBy: LO4P123CA0131.GBRP123.PROD.OUTLOOK.COM (2603:10a6:600:193::10) To MWHPR11MB1629.namprd11.prod.outlook.com (2603:10b6:301:d::21)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: MWHPR11MB1629:EE_|CY5PR11MB6283:EE_ X-MS-Office365-Filtering-Correlation-Id: ef0e74f4-2f83-458f-16a8-08dace2db27f X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: vnSbjgeBLyeGVwwbqIGsNmvIycMdmsQqHscg9Xj0KMHXfZDFCN3H03G4w2jRO04GB1+mO41kfBEUKNHAmx7JLt1kZrfK9ApJ2XqSzWZQ/+1Wvv9d+OmGWXoN1QwzNhz/L1/cn8Qt3myPOeB5cfubTVq1pQo8ghEfCksxF2IMbyg16sR6bKMRUh7quY5lrHGmyfwDfv6wSaU1aRXLobrrxFdsR+0apHRr3jUxzU9I5ofLP1fLZjp7xzSnBgFlBjc9jw0f8zmiF82XczsZNcv1WF9UCXOQJzua7cab5Y0//2r7KL+0GYKmlhavV9ZadjAA7XJXiZYz/uNQ/282ofTwjRFbqtltIieHKBitroHlPwz0vlYwf8auIxa7g12wG2PXDfM20hbKtB5zTFURd9fnngg1YSdqL+CavRoL6wube/yGX3wG/+BMxF4VjhhTdvOTzhRYBa1dlNHVKZYQMGbzxb799dU0F++BuwAMbO10B2SEPqFMjoWiYH1TcvAQoVqfffIpCl3RsQHP5qSDwzSaI8X5b12nRqEqrhU3VBJrwp2FdaZcrJel2lTey/te/AHCRK6ihWDSK/QliAJPrNKb1DvZ0p4o4u68qDPzBxq5uLPkhY16M7rsPZ79w50l50ObBOVMDwPhGkZUJYjKvNwjmA== X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:MWHPR11MB1629.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(13230022)(136003)(39860400002)(376002)(346002)(396003)(366004)(451199015)(478600001)(4326008)(66556008)(6486002)(8676002)(66476007)(66946007)(41300700001)(316002)(83380400001)(38100700002)(82960400001)(53546011)(6666004)(6506007)(186003)(6916009)(6512007)(26005)(86362001)(5660300002)(2906002)(44832011)(8936002);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?us-ascii?Q?0782VPHf6ucBegjqFfxeJyyieFVEhduVWbbDRvBkxt/BROf0v90M2IcpdE33?= =?us-ascii?Q?o/Rrjs8RVrfuyof2ZXQLD6Bk0IDXQK8/C1hC1R1CAIEtnq3tLNxL++RosFdI?= =?us-ascii?Q?iLyY3hYupO7QB9dmsMX3eoKn9zUPdDGdlscPirfkzjGdtgBunPQNxGgPF0X7?= =?us-ascii?Q?M/0YN6TKqR4mvQJ+ZVvpmsgaWDQRgHeLPi6pm3xqWZm07Lb9yrbxTkfnfKLx?= =?us-ascii?Q?MWzfcbTrtEcxjLTZcFk+NzLv20C+vV95VJA9H5jKHc+rgEqn3FfjCpmtO9ZS?= =?us-ascii?Q?5gsqb9L/blRbWIKH9GywZp3RZFKTPJqJSfQTdiVX0VQxCRAK0wUbN6tjn5Xy?= =?us-ascii?Q?Sd/H0DjngzQ4Os+5P1S4/hWCUSzLMxp6JrzjpT+xB19FtT821WZ/Ym+ekUF1?= =?us-ascii?Q?MFAttmb8ulrtELx9gUammj4o1r3MkGuPW4SyyPQFYJ3J82j29F+ZgEG31Z/D?= =?us-ascii?Q?ISo0t7p2cr5tf6mD861xmyxS3fDL6LSKZgjE018J+cDPgqSo4KEXy2YEkqgq?= =?us-ascii?Q?ODx1T5yKxBsz4zGZTF2qohBqZnL3LeM1QucxxILUfeAiBrfymGjHDBuEoYCo?= =?us-ascii?Q?8IXuCsWkkGQE7rQj5tip3xfsUy4AfHoV+Lh9YzzKvrcKGaOA1mCRH60VuqIw?= =?us-ascii?Q?ktyVLZzCSaCVaV5aSx4vOqZQQmfCFVjFRvAYOhex2kn2A/4WUW7ZtisV5VL3?= =?us-ascii?Q?nfUenkvqX7E/7PBo+DxqjCJa6UBR2RrZdLqfLD29JFqxHvbT5q1DfJ8alHWu?= =?us-ascii?Q?RTf4e3FYgGnxeefhkRk9DgNa3VsbrnkGlAL51X8ygygFvE12/FMuDmxeXVNB?= =?us-ascii?Q?9EkgHXpIG6Pc81tqxzD9hlXbnqaJwEYlGlNugDISIVNcHZEyX02sF8OcNKVZ?= =?us-ascii?Q?+ZKacCQHM1gKKP3LXe0UzUzeGJo15CB9rpmVBW2K9hJaqg7KJNGxWQQaDulW?= =?us-ascii?Q?ojNTyz6lApaOQka+oaUVoGq/iA52TpdfvZbBzPx/FxwEkhOP3h9+89I06VC1?= =?us-ascii?Q?lOkr/lBzS8DNoT4ItUJ6Krdwif9eAuMk8l4V6cHhh0XXclYKkrXlTY6qBSCd?= =?us-ascii?Q?qAZeFvPKcoDdSu48DCW0SAw5yBNsP46Rf1OMQ7dFYCzkTj/GHXRLT37t3F+G?= =?us-ascii?Q?sQzan2sTqocgQ0gpv0p7a5Ufo9xGKw+NidSGUZgT2zKth0PWMzBUM0+XJAJQ?= =?us-ascii?Q?VcCFgKXYLQw0kdLQmYCVW7EAoBJz1mQU3blDbeTw/OqmQkYnpAiYzLuMnOks?= =?us-ascii?Q?4MjtMcex8zYoQsdpLMCzBPaViq9ANE8bnB3NgCRNg67isggZUYDMYs/Jindd?= =?us-ascii?Q?f/OvXqoIKV1+RJLP/SaTiRTz4Qfq3v6/uYku7fxwjs+5MHMNnvSPoZ6wRgLq?= =?us-ascii?Q?lkJUTn2Rzp2DOxXQUgOY52vam57Xb+y/Skahc+t3nAr3yWtTqH23BXwpOCvv?= =?us-ascii?Q?FjB11MZ6JBD7e/q0dF3brO2i9ZrTpf6Us8pgCyhsjNxsKWYGqivxuZoooom5?= =?us-ascii?Q?G+nAMn/VU9F1tqkJw4TxUxU1RblnpIp5AgTCYT4s/YXcAfKFeMZ9sjs2eBI+?= =?us-ascii?Q?W/3Fhu3k2we5ujAlfH6/Y2g+NF99Xoj/HYhaLeVxb/1E6UazVDPgYYJNsvbw?= =?us-ascii?Q?CQ=3D=3D?= X-MS-Exchange-CrossTenant-Network-Message-Id: ef0e74f4-2f83-458f-16a8-08dace2db27f X-MS-Exchange-CrossTenant-AuthSource: MWHPR11MB1629.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 24 Nov 2022 15:08:09.2526 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: u2eMMh6MzBucn/rXZfnvnJ3ehf1pl8Skl2C7eCyoRPagB0KVFiYojgEyAjDFOslUEFJZolXryWosHcUv5SaYdGltMACx3Wyh+y9cnpXHE0Y= X-MS-Exchange-Transport-CrossTenantHeadersStamped: CY5PR11MB6283 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On Thu, Nov 24, 2022 at 02:57:17PM +0100, Thomas Monjalon wrote: > 24/11/2022 14:49, David Marchand: > > On Thu, Nov 24, 2022 at 2:43 PM Bruce Richardson > > wrote: > > > > > > On Thu, Nov 24, 2022 at 01:13:20PM +0100, David Marchand wrote: > > > > From: Bruce Richardson > > > > > > > > Since a number of contributors to DPDK have submitted patches to DPDK > > > > under more than one email address, we should maintain a mailmap file to > > > > properly track their commits using "shortlog". > > > > > > > > It also helps fix up any mangled names, for example, with > > > > surname/firstname reversed, or with incorrect capitalization. > > > > By keeping this file in the DPDK repository, rather than committers > > > > maintaining their own copies, it allows individual contributors to edit > > > > it to update their own email address preferences if so desired. > > > > > > > > While at it, update our checkpatches.sh script and add some > > > > documentation to help new contributors. > > > > > > > > Signed-off-by: Bruce Richardson > > > > Signed-off-by: David Marchand > > > > --- > > > > Changes since v3: > > > > - fixed some issues with non iso characters in names, > > > > - added .mailmap to MAINTAINERS, > > > > - populated .mailmap with the contributors file Thomas and I maintain, > > > > - added a check so that people will stop mangling their own names, > > > > - added a note in the contributing guide, > > > > > > > Do we really want to require all contributors to add their names to the > > > mailmap file, it seems excessive to me and onerous on new contributors? I > > > would expect the mailmap to be only necessary for tracking mail updates, or > > > fixing already-mangled names. > > > > As someone who checks those names and fixes some regularly, I prefer > > developers check this themselves. > > If a new contributor does not edit this file, it can be done while merging. > That would be ok, I think. I just don't want to have extra hurdles for new contributors to jump through. Thanks for this. /Bruce